36 lines
831 B
Scheme
36 lines
831 B
Scheme
; SPDX-License-Identifier: Apache-2.0
|
|
; Source: nvim-treesitter (https://github.com/nvim-treesitter/nvim-treesitter)
|
|
|
|
((Comment) @injection.content
|
|
(#set! injection.language "comment"))
|
|
|
|
; SVG style
|
|
((element
|
|
(STag
|
|
(Name) @_name)
|
|
(content) @injection.content)
|
|
(#eq? @_name "style")
|
|
(#set! injection.combined)
|
|
(#set! injection.include-children)
|
|
(#set! injection.language "css"))
|
|
|
|
; SVG script
|
|
((element
|
|
(STag
|
|
(Name) @_name)
|
|
(content) @injection.content)
|
|
(#eq? @_name "script")
|
|
(#set! injection.combined)
|
|
(#set! injection.include-children)
|
|
(#set! injection.language "javascript"))
|
|
|
|
; phpMyAdmin dump
|
|
((element
|
|
(STag
|
|
(Name) @_name)
|
|
(content) @injection.content)
|
|
(#eq? @_name "pma:table")
|
|
(#set! injection.combined)
|
|
(#set! injection.include-children)
|
|
(#set! injection.language "sql"))
|